Transaction 77b862358dc34d21d3b117fcc949456b712a681779ba7215c4984b6f623018c7

1 Input
2 Outputs
  • 77b862358dc34d21d3b117fcc949456b712a681779ba7215c4984b6f623018c7:0
  • value  33597
    address  1NTPYvXFmJkPL77KfYLEzgAxz6okv7o7PJ
  • 77b862358dc34d21d3b117fcc949456b712a681779ba7215c4984b6f623018c7:1
  • value  683845
    address  38vT3vK35MWv3uKj1XcCWvLWs37pDoLpRd